[jira] [Updated] (CSV-189) CSVParser: Add constructor accepting InputStream

    Description: 
Please supply a CSVParser.parse operation accepting an InputStream, e.g. 

{code:java}
public static CSVParser parse(InputStream stream, final CSVFormat format) throws IOException {
        Assertions.notNull(stream, "stream");
        Assertions.notNull(format, "format");

        return new CSVParser(new InputStreamReader(stream), format);
}
{code}

This can be used more widely than File or String, and helps reading from resources (getClassLoader().getResourceAsStream()).
